  • Hezbollah using IOF as testing ground for weapons: Israeli media
    A screen grab from a video showing the moment Hezbollah fighters attacked the al-Raheb Israeli military site on the border with occupied Palestine with Burkan rockets, on March 12, 2024. (Hezbollah military media)

Israeli media reported today, Sunday, on developments in the ongoing war on the northern front, stating that it is gradually becoming the "main front" at the moment. The reports addressed Hezbollah's military capabilities and its handling of field developments.

The North is gradually becoming the "main front" as Hezbollah increases the scope and intensity of operations while utilizing only a fraction of its capabilities, Israeli media reported on Sunday.

The Resistance in Lebanon "has used only 5% of its weapons arsenal during these months of battle as a testing ground against the Israeli army, in preparation for a real and extensive battle," Ynet reported, citing the occupation army.

The news website added that Hezbollah "tries every day to bypass air defense systems and derive lessons," and that  "this has become evident with the different launch angles [the Resistance] uses, the concentration of launches, and the varying amounts of explosives in each weapon fired, among other factors."

Thus, despite the "relatively limited volume of fire compared to the quantities" Hezbollah possesses, the Resistance "is registering accurate and successful hits," the outlet added, pointing out to the operation using the Burkan heavy rockets on Saturday targeting the 769th Brigade HQ, "Camp Gibor," causing severe damage to the military base.

The report added that "the use of Burkan rockets has proven effective in terms of material and psychological damage," citing its "impact due to the unusual levels of destruction caused by each of these rockets, which are known as heavy rockets and can carry up to half a ton of explosives."

The website also noted that "in recent months, similar to updates introduced to the anti-tank Almas missile, Hezbollah has developed a new family of Burkan rockets with warheads that exceed a ton of explosives" compared to earlier versions with a maximum capacity of 500kg of explosives.

'To be or not to be'

Israeli Reserve Major General Gershon Hacohen warned on Saturday that "Israel" is currently facing an "existential threat" from Hezbollah, with its motto being "to be or not to be," emphasizing that the occupation entity lacks the military capability to eliminate the threat posed by the Lebanese Resistance group.

Hacohen told the Israeli Channel 14 that "Israel's" system of concepts and lifestyles must change, warning that "tomorrow we may not be here if we do not prepare ourselves for a situation we have not witnessed before."

The Israeli Major General explained that the Israeli military does not currently possess "the size of forces capable of decisive action against Hezbollah..."

"Lebanon is a large country and Hezbollah is spread across all its territory, even in the depths of Lebanon," he added.

"You must understand that the Israeli army is small, and not only Haredim (ultra-Orthodox Jews) but hundreds of thousands of those exempted from service from the age of 20 to 50 must be recruited to build three or four divisions, and then we can talk," Hacohen told the Israeli Channel 14.

His statements coincide with a new study conducted by Tel Hai Academic College in "Israel" which revealed that around 40% of Israelis who fled from the settlements in northern occupied Palestine are contemplating not returning even after the war ends.
